Erlang 在“cowboy_req”模块中,如何设置';长度';和';期间';应用程序配置中的值?
我遇到了一个HTTP 413错误,消息是从Cowboy冒出来的Erlang 在“cowboy_req”模块中,如何设置';长度';和';期间';应用程序配置中的值?,erlang,elixir,phoenix,cowboy,Erlang,Elixir,Phoenix,Cowboy,我遇到了一个HTTP 413错误,消息是从Cowboy冒出来的payload\u too\u large。似乎我的HTTP客户端正在上载一个比默认值64K更长的正文,我还没有想出如何增加该值。函数cowboy\u req:read\u body和cowboy\u req:read\u urlcoded\u body有两个变量,第二个参数是选项的映射。您可以将最大尺寸指定为长度: cowboy_req:read_urlencoded_body(Req, #{length => 100000}
payload\u too\u large
。似乎我的HTTP客户端正在上载一个比默认值64K
更长的正文,我还没有想出如何增加该值。函数cowboy\u req:read\u body
和cowboy\u req:read\u urlcoded\u body
有两个变量,第二个参数是选项的映射。您可以将最大尺寸指定为长度:
cowboy_req:read_urlencoded_body(Req, #{length => 100000})
有关更多详细信息,请参阅